在现代软件开发中,GitHub是一个极为重要的平台,它不仅可以托管代码,还能与其他开发者进行协作。在使用GitHub时,raw网址常常被用来直接访问文件内容,这对于许多开发者来说非常有用。本文将深入探讨如何在GitHub上获取raw网址,提供详细的步骤和相关信息。
什么是raw网址
Raw网址是指GitHub上存储文件的直接链接,它能够直接显示文件内容,而不是在GitHub的用户界面中查看。这对于许多需要引用文件内容的应用场景非常实用,尤其是在需要直接访问文件的API请求或者下载文件的情况下。
如何获取raw网址
获取raw网址的步骤相对简单,以下是详细的操作流程:
第一步:打开GitHub项目
- 登录你的GitHub账户。
- 找到你想要获取raw网址的项目,点击进入该项目的页面。
第二步:定位到目标文件
- 在项目页面,浏览到想要获取raw网址的具体文件。
- 点击文件名进入文件的详细视图。
第三步:获取raw网址
- 在文件详细视图的右上角,你会看到一个“Raw”按钮。
- 点击“Raw”按钮,页面将会跳转到文件的raw格式显示。
- 复制浏览器地址栏中的网址,这就是该文件的raw网址。
示例
如果你的GitHub项目的文件结构如下:
my-repo/ └── folder/ └── example.txt
那么获取example.txt的raw网址的步骤就是:
- 进入
my-repo
项目。 - 浏览到
folder
文件夹并点击example.txt
。 - 点击“Raw”按钮,复制地址栏的URL,得到raw网址。
raw网址的用途
获取raw网址的用途非常广泛,以下是一些常见的应用场景:
- 直接下载文件:通过raw网址,用户可以直接下载文件,而无需浏览GitHub界面。
- API集成:在编写应用时,可以使用raw网址来获取配置文件或数据文件。
- 引用资源:在网页或文档中直接引用raw网址,便于共享资源。
FAQ:关于获取GitHub raw网址的常见问题
1. GitHub的raw网址有什么限制吗?
GitHub的raw网址有一些使用限制,主要包括:
- 带宽限制:GitHub对raw文件的下载量设有带宽限制,过多的请求可能会导致访问受限。
- 文件大小限制:大于100MB的文件将无法通过raw网址访问。
2. 如何确保我获得的raw网址是正确的?
你可以通过以下方法确保raw网址的正确性:
- 验证文件内容:通过浏览器访问raw网址,确认显示的内容与目标文件一致。
- 使用curl命令:在终端使用curl命令,可以直接获取文件内容以确认有效性。例如:
curl -O <raw网址>
。
3. GitHub的raw网址会过期吗?
一般情况下,GitHub的raw网址不会过期,前提是文件仍然存在于相应的GitHub项目中。如果文件被删除,raw网址将不再有效。
4. 如何批量获取raw网址?
批量获取raw网址的方法主要依赖于脚本。你可以使用Python、Shell等编程语言遍历GitHub API,自动获取项目中所有文件的raw网址。具体示例代码可以在GitHub的开发者文档中找到。
总结
获取GitHub上的raw网址是一个简单而实用的过程,对于开发者而言,能够有效提高工作效率。无论是直接下载文件还是进行API集成,raw网址的作用都不可小觑。通过本文提供的详细步骤和FAQ解答,希望能帮助你更好地使用GitHub的资源。
正文完